Do laptop cameras turn on by themselves?

Yes and no!

If a zoom or other application has a scheduled video meeting and the user accepts the invitation even days before and the settings are set to automatic, then at the exact time the meeting starts the application launches and turns on the camera and microphone.

Usually these settings should be set to manual but in many cases because some people seem incapable of understanding how a computer works, the IT support people set things up and turn everything to auto to avoid a bunch of people contacting them to ask how to start or join the meeting.
